Background: COX-1

COX-1 is an approximately 70 kDa protein that is associated with microsomal membranes. COX-1 participates in the synthesis of prostaglandins and is the enzymatic target of non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s. A splice variant of COX-1 is generated by internal deletion of 37 residues. Human COX-1 shares 88%‑90% amino acid sequence identity with mouse and rat COX-1.
